This actions is somewhat peculiar to regular stage chromatography as it is governed Nearly completely by an adsorptive mechanism (i.e., analytes communicate with a reliable surface area in lieu of with the solvated layer of the ligand attached to your sorbent surface area; see also reversed-stage HPLC down below). Adsorption chromatography remains rather useful for structural isomer separations in both equally column and slim-layer chromatography formats on activated (dried) silica or alumina supports.[citation desired]

Reversed stage columns are rather challenging to harm in comparison to regular silica columns, due to the shielding impact of the bonded hydrophobic ligands; nonetheless, most reversed phase columns include alkyl derivatized silica particles, and therefore are prone to hydrolysis with the silica at Serious pH circumstances in the mobile phase. Most varieties of RP columns should not be utilized with aqueous bases as these will hydrolyze the fundamental silica particle and dissolve it.
